Overview
The climate in Belleville is characterized as moderate continental, with distinct seasonal changes. For travelers, this means the weather is varied: each season brings its own unique colors and atmosphere. Summers here are generally warm and comfortable, perfect for outdoor activities, while winter brings true Canadian frost and snow.
The warmest period lasts from June to August, when the average daytime temperature often exceeds 20°C, and in July it can reach 26°C. In contrast, winters are cold: from December to February, the mercury stays consistently below freezing, dropping to an average of -5°C in January. Tourists planning a visit in the winter months should definitely pack warm clothing to enjoy the snowy landscapes without discomfort.
A characteristic feature of the local climate is the stability of precipitation. Belleville does not have a pronounced rainy or dry season: the number of days with precipitation remains roughly the same throughout the year (averaging 9 to 13 days per month). Spring and autumn serve as cool but pleasant transitions between seasons, when nature changes its colors and the air temperature gradually shifts from moderate positive values to frosts or vice versa.
Temperature
The temperature regime in Belleville is characterized by a classic change of seasons with a noticeable contrast between winter and summer. The coldest month of the year is traditionally January, when the mercury drops to an average of -5.0°C, and night frosts can reach -8.7°C. In contrast, the peak of the heat occurs in July: at this time, the air warms up to a comfortable 26.6°C during the day, creating ideal conditions for a summer vacation.
The summer period in the city can be described as pleasantly warm, but without exhausting heat. The average temperature in July and August stays above 21°C, while nights remain quite mild and warm (around 17-18°C), allowing for long evening walks. September retains echoes of summer with average figures around 17.9°C, offering tourists comfortable weather before the autumn chill sets in.
Winter in Belleville sets in firmly: from December to February, average temperatures stay consistently below zero. February, like January, remains a frosty month with lows around -7.7°C. Transitional seasons, such as April and November, are cool (ranging from 4°C to 6.6°C), so warm clothing will be required for a trip at this time of year. However, by May, the city warms up significantly, reaching pleasant daytime highs of 18.7°C.

Precipitation
Precipitation in Belleville is distributed fairly evenly throughout the year, so it's difficult to identify a distinct dry or rainy season. On average, inclement weather is observed for 11 to 13 days per month, making an umbrella or raincoat a useful accessory for any trip. The type of precipitation depends directly on the temperature: during frosty winters, especially in January and February, the city is often covered in snowfall, while it rains from spring through late autumn.
The "wettest" period is considered to be April, which sees the maximum amount of precipitation (about 4 mm), with rain falling roughly 13 days a month. A similar frequency of precipitation is observed in October and December. The most favorable time statistically is September: the number of days with precipitation drops to 9, offering a better chance of clear days for walking around the city.
In summer, despite the warm weather with an average temperature of about 22°C in July, rain is not uncommon. June and August record about 12 rainy days. However, summer precipitation is often short-lived, quickly giving way to sunshine, whereas late autumn and early spring can be more overcast.

Packing Tips
Traveling to Belleville requires a thoughtful approach to packing, as the weather here has pronounced seasonality. In winter, when temperatures stay consistently below freezing, you will definitely need a warm windproof jacket or parka, a hat, a scarf, and gloves. Don't forget high-quality winter boots with non-slip soles to feel confident on snowy streets, while a set of thermal underwear will make long walks in the fresh air much more comfortable.
Summer in this Canadian city is usually warm and pleasant, with average temperatures around +22°C, which is ideal for sightseeing. For a trip between June and August, pack light t-shirts, shorts, and breathable clothing made from natural fabrics. However, evenings can be cool, so a hoodie, denim jacket, or light cardigan in your luggage won't go amiss. Also, be sure to bring sunscreen and sunglasses: the sun can be strong even on cloudy days.
Spring and autumn in Belleville are often unpredictable, so the smartest choice is to use the principle of layering to easily adapt to temperature changes throughout the day. Since statistics show that precipitation falls quite regularly year-round (averaging 11–13 days per month), a compact umbrella or a high-quality raincoat will be indispensable items in your backpack. And, of course, regardless of the season, choose comfortable and broken-in walking shoes to enjoy exploring the city.
